iTunes (sometimes) can't find music on external...
I put all my music on an external hard drive. I set this location in Advanced Preferences/iTunes Media folder location. However, it find music sometimes and sometimes doesn't. I have no idea what makes some work and some not. When I look at the info as to where iTunes is looking for the file I find the following:
/Volumes/EXTERNAL_DRIVE/iTunes/Music/Band/Album/song1.mp3 (this one works)
file:///Volumes/EXTERNAL_DRIVE/iTunes/Music/Band/Album/song2.mp3 (this one doesn't)
What is going on? How do I correctly map my music without individually fixing 100,000s of songs?
In general it ought to work as long as the drive is ready before you start iTunes. If it isn't iTunes might treat some tracks as unavailable. If the tracks are in the expected layout then fixing one link, when iTunes show exclamation marks for others it thinks are missing, should let it fix them all. See Make a split library portable for advice on putting the library in a layout that is easy to backup, and restore when needed, and should be less likely to suffer from this issue.
